Output 9395086ce5a0c9db80ebbd4f068fe5dd5f57c6d49c6f890e5be4a7e047c45d59:1

value
148531
script pubkey
OP_0 OP_PUSHBYTES_20 9443bdcb1fd0581682d7e92a391c16354e6cedbf
address
bc1qj3pmmjcl6pvpdqkhay4rj8qkx48xemdlemgcw8
transaction
9395086ce5a0c9db80ebbd4f068fe5dd5f57c6d49c6f890e5be4a7e047c45d59